Wright, John, Calvert County, 6th Feb., 1673; 24th Feb., 1673.
To William Eyles, Philip Cookesey and godson John AlwelI, personalty.
Thomas Trueman, ex. and residuary legatee.
Test: Robt. Philips, Eliza: Price. 1.591,
